Okay, I finally watched I Am Legend, and I have to say I was incredibly underwhelmed. I found the movie formulaic and almost problematic. When I hoped for a movie that would show us some depth to Will Smith's character, all I got was the typical post-apocalyptic fodder. It's decent as entertainment, but doesn't really work as a movie. Granted, Will Smith does give a good performance as Robert Neville, but I would have loved to have seen more of his evolution into the man he is now from the man he was three years ago; for the movie to show me his lapse into his lonely madness, if you will. The opening scenes are riveting, and Neville's flashback's are great pieces of film, but the movie itself lacks thought in some areas, and over thinks in others. If Neville is the last man on earth, who is he the cure for? And how does Anna get on the island if all the bridges have been destroyed and the island has been quarantined? As curious as that may be, the movie still, some how, works. In no way is this a good movie, but it is entertaining, and by that merit, I do recommend it.
